It depends on the formality. For a formal wedding, definitely rent dishes. I would never purchase dishes to be used because when are you going to host another formal party of that size and where would you store them? For a semiformal wedding, you can rent real dishes or have the caterer provide heavy duty disposables.
I’m doing heavy duty disposable, they’re like $25 for 100 & simple clean up & it would cost more to rent. Only thing I’m buying is my champagne glasses everything else will be heavy duty disposable even wine glasses all from amazon.
